Logistics and Japanese Customs Compliance
Once your OP-XY arrives at our warehouse, you can forward packages to your Japanese address via premium carriers. It is vital to understand that importing electronics into Japan involves specific import duties and consumption taxes. Generally, for personal imports, you will be responsible for a consumption tax (currently around 10%) on 60% of the item's value, though specific customs tax rules apply to professional-grade equipment.
Failure to account for these costs in your budget can lead to delays at the border.
